Don't talk to the Insurance Company

It's understandable that you may be tempted to relay your part of the story to the insurance company when they call. This can be a big mistake. Insurance companies aren't on your side; it's their job to make sure you get as little as possible. Insurance representatives will let you talk for as long as they want, hoping that you will make a statement that they can use to discredit your claim or blame you for the accident.

Try to keep your conversation focussed on the facts of the crash. Don't speculate, or make assumptions about what transpired during the accident. This could cause problems in your situation. An insurance representative will be watching closely, looking for any tidbits of information they can use to deny your claim or reduce the amount you are awarded.

If the other driver's insurance company asks you to give an unwritten or recorded statement, don't accept. This is a typical tactic to try and get you to confess to something that could be used against you in the course of settlement negotiations. It's best to avoid giving these statements at all and instead address any concerns to your attorney.

Your lawyer can handle any discussions with the insurance company on your behalf, so that you don't have to make any compromising statements. Your attorney can provide the insurer of the other party with your medical records to help them comprehend the extent of the damage and injuries you've suffered.

Don't Admit Fault

It's tempting to apologize for an accident or admit that you were at fault particularly if you observe the driver in the other vehicle angry and frustrated. However, it's crucial to stay clear of these urges and refrain from making any statements that could be used against you later. Even if you're correct admitting that you are wrong can hurt your case and make it more difficult to get the compensation that you deserve.

In addition to not making excuses at the scene of an accident, you should also not discuss the incident with other drivers or anyone else who was involved. You can share information with the other driver such as contact numbers and insurance coverage, but do not discuss what transpired or who is at fault. Inform the authorities so that a complete and complete police report can be made.

Any statement you make at the scene of an accident can be used against you in court, so it's best to keep quiet until you speak with a lawyer. Insurance companies and lawyers who have an interest in the accident may try to portray you as the person responsible for the accident which could harm your case and increase the liability you must pay.

You can help your case by being open and honest about the incident to your attorney and the other parties involved. Take photos of the site of the accident, and include any visible damage. This will help you create a valuable document that can be used to back your account of the incident.

Don't accept the initial Settlement Offer

You could receive an offer of settlement from your insurance company after you have filed an auto accident claim. This offer is likely to be from an adjuster at the insurance company and is usually extremely low. It is better to reject the initial offer and let your lawyer assist you negotiate for a more reasonable amount.

Keep in mind that insurance companies are in business to make money, and so they will attempt to pay you the least amount possible. It is essential to have an attorney to your side. Your lawyer will level the playing field, and will have an understanding of the amount your claim is valued at. This is essential when negotiating with an adjuster.

They also know that you are facing an increasing medical bill and have lost income from being unable to work due to your injuries. This is why you must make the effort to calculate all your expenses as well as non-economic damages, such as suffering and pain, and add them to your demand letter.

Depending on your injury, it could be months or even years before you are completely healed and have a clear picture of the impact your injuries will have on your life in the future. When you agree to a settlement, you will also give up your right to sue for additional compensation in the future should the need arise.

You can safeguard yourself by rescinding the initial settlement offer after an accident. However, you must also be prepared for the insurance company to respond with a better offer. If the insurance company doesn't increase their offer then you may want to consider making a claim for personal injury.
